The Galaxy A30s has a score of 79.8, which is much better than the Nokia X10's 71.8 score. Both phones we are comparing here work with the same Android 11 OS (operating system), so both of them should offer the same operating system features. The Galaxy A30s design is somewhat thinner and incredibly lighter than the Nokia X10, although it was released just 22 months before.
Nokia X10 features a little better processing power than Galaxy A30s,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Nokia X10 also has 2 GB more RAM. Nokia X10 has a much better looking screen than Samsung Galaxy A30s, because it has a quite bigger screen, a way better 1080 x 2400 resolution and a greater pixel density.
The Samsung Galaxy A30s has a much bigger storage capacity for games and applications than Nokia X10, and although they both have a SD memory card expansion slot that allows up to 512 GB, the Samsung Galaxy A30s also has 64 GB more internal memory. Galaxy A30s shoots better videos and photos than Nokia X10, although it has a lot lower resolution camera.
Nokia X10 features just a bit longer battery duration than Galaxy A30s, because it has a 4470mAh battery size against 4000mAh.
